The EQB-Pascal project has been officially approved
FBK/ECT* is participating in the EQB-Pascal project, funded by EURAMET and aimed at revolutionizing pressure measurement through the development of quantum-based technologies. As the scientific community moves away from traditional methods—such as those relying on mercury or complex mechanical parts—this project seeks to establish a more efficient and resilient European metrological infrastructure. By transitioning advanced quantum systems from laboratory prototypes into practical, integrated applications, EQB-Pascal aims to strengthen Europe’s technological sovereignty and provide high-performance measurement standards for manufacturing, environmental monitoring, and industrial process control.
ECT* will play a significant role in the theoretical modeling aspects of the EQB-Pascal project, specifically regarding the determination of thermophysical properties for gas mixtures, leveraging over 15 years of expertise in calculating virial coefficients for atomic and molecular systems.
